UnNamed

Startseite

Nachricht beantworten
Autor: guilde
Datum:  
To: guilde
Alte Treads: [...]
Betreff: UnNamed
> de Dianous writes:
> > j'ai eu entendu dire que, sur un serveur, si un programme est apellé
> > plusieurs fois, il n'est en fait chargé qu'une foi pour tous les
> > utilisateurs.
> > qu'en est il des librairies statiques ? exemple sur Saroffice ?
>
> Je ne pense pas. Si on lance deux fois (ou deux utilisateurs lancent)
> un meme programe, c'est deux versions de celui-ci qui seront chargees
> en memoire. Seules les libraries dynamiques sont partages. D'ou
> l'interet des ce type de librarie.


Je ne crois pas.
Si plusieurs utilisateurs lancent le meme programme (c'est le chemin complet qui
compte ex: /bin/ls), le code executable (text) ne sera present qu'une seule fois
en memoire. Ce qui est present une fois par session sont les piles d'execution et
autre zones de donnees.
Preuve: le sticky bit positionne sur les executables les plus utilises.

+------------------------------------------+
| Gilles CARRY - HP-France - IT Grenoble   |
| gilles_carry@??? |
| Tel: (33) 4 76 14 12 83                  |
| Telnet: 779-1283                         |

+------------------------------------------+